1961: HOUSE UN-AMERICAN ACTIVITIES COMMITTEE REQUESTED TO LIMIT ITS SCOPE St. Louis, 1961

HOUSE UN-AMERICAN ACTIVITIES COMMITTEE REQUESTED TO LIMIT ITS SCOPE SO AS TO AVOID IMPROPER PRACTICES

WHEREAS the Un-American Activities Committee of the House of Representatives has engaged in "trial by publicity" and "guilt by association"; and has repeatedly overstepped its function as an investigative instrument of the Legislature;

WHEREAS such abuses have to date overshadowed and outweighed the Committee's contributions in the formulation of legislation;

WHEREAS enforcement of the laws concerning security of this country belong within the realm of the Judiciary and Executive and not of the Legislative arm of Government and can be better and more justly dealt with by such organs as the Department of Justice and the Courts;

BE IT THEREFORE RESOLVED that the American Ethical Union, a federation of all Ethical Culture Societies in the United States, meeting in Annual Assembly in St. Louis, Missouri, request that the House of Representatives give serious and immediate consideration to curbing abuses.
